Description
The dryers of the DF series basically consist of two separate circuits:
One compressed air circuit split into two heat exchangers, and one refrigerating circuit. Incoming warm, humid compressed air passes over the air-air exchanger and then continues into the condenser, where on contact with the refrigerating circuit it is cooled to the pre-set dew point so that the humidity it contains condenses out. The condensate is separated and removed in the separator.
There are basically two advantages to this system: firstly, air entering the system goes through a pre-cooling stage so the refrigeration plant can be scaled down to provide a smaller temperature gradient, with energy savings of 40-50, and secondly cold air is not injected into the compressed air line, thus preventing condensation on the outside of the line's pipes.
